Azerbaijan to accept most advantageous price proposal on gas export: minister

Oil&Gas Materials 3 June 2009 15:56 (UTC +04:00)

Azerbaijan, Baku, June 3 / Trend , A.Badalova/

To sell own gas, Azerbaijan will accept the most advantageous proposal from a commercial point of view, Azerbaijani Industry and Energy Minister Natig Aliyev said on June 3.

"We will sell our gas in the direction which will be the most advantageous, i.e. on which we can sell the gas more expensive," Aliyev said.

Aliyev said the gas negotiations between Gazprom and SOCAR will take place within a long period of time.

"At present we do not speak about any short-term deal. I believe both sides are solving strategic issues and issues of long-term cooperation," Aliyev said.

The minister said there are a lot of proposals to buy the Azerbaijani gas. Thus, Iran offered to purchase gas as part of the second development phase of the Shah Deniz field.

It is necessary to study all conditions and proposals through the negotiations, Aliyev said. The whole volume of gas will not be sold in one direction, the minister said.

"In the most cases, gas will be sold at the highest price. We will accept the proposal, which will be beneficial for us," Aliyev said.
